Massey Ferguson 2615 48hp, 4wd, loader
How hot is too hot for a synchroshift geared tranny with 10 wt. hydraulic/transmission fluid? Mine is getting hot enough to burn me if I touch the transmission cover, brake pedals, clutch pedal ot the transmission casing itself.

Normally 180 - 200 degrees F is considered the max temperature before the oil or seals are compromised. 130-140 degrees is where it is so hot you will get burns from touching something.

Do you have some thing in the hydraulic system adding heat? Like 3PH control stuck in the raised position, Directional valve lever being held partially shifted, etc..
 
/ Hot Tranny #4  
Modern hydraulics are designed for somewhat higher operating temps. Even temps of 210 for short periods will not damage the seals. That is the big issue with transmissions, having the seals begin to deteriorate due to heat. If you think it is running too hot see if you can find someone with one of those laser reading infrared thermometers, greatest thing since tachometers for assurance and troubleshooting.
 
/ Hot Tranny #5  
If you can find the right size seals in Viton it will handle more heat and still seal
